본문 바로가기 메뉴 바로가기

Jun's TID

프로필사진

Jun's TID

Jun's TID
검색하기 폼 Mountain View
  • 분류 전체보기 (509)
    • 정보관리기술사 (0)
      • Network (0)
    • Mobile (158)
      • Android (71)
      • Dart (5)
      • Flutter (9)
      • ios (38)
      • react-native (35)
    • WEB (110)
      • DynamicWeb (33)
      • 자바스크립트 (22)
      • CSS (4)
      • jQuery (21)
      • ajax (4)
      • JPA (2)
      • React (21)
      • Node (3)
    • Database (25)
    • [Python] (35)
      • 문자열 조작 (4)
      • 선형 자료구조 (7)
      • Machine learning (17)
    • [JAVA] (111)
      • Spring-Boot (12)
      • Spring (47)
      • JExcel (3)
      • BeakJoon (4)
      • Programmers (23)
      • JAVA (8)
      • Algorithms (8)
      • Mybatis (6)
    • Network (12)
    • Projects (9)
    • Support (10)
    • 프로젝트 분석 (4)
    • English (8)
    • Life (2)
      • 운동냥이 (0)
      • 맛집냥이 (1)
      • 커피냥이 (0)
    • 정보보안기사 (2)
    • C++ (15)
      • 참고 (11)
      • 연습 문제 (4)
    • 누리 임보 일기 (7)
  • GUESTBOOK
  • TAG
  • RSS

[JAVA]/JExcel
"웹 개발자 양성과정" 03.26 <jExcel 심화 문제>

주어진 엑셀 파일을 이용하여 1번부터 3번까지 문제에 대한 정답을 HTML 파일로 만들어 출력하는 프로젝트이다. 각 인구의 합계는 개별 데이터를 가져와서 합해주는 연산을 해주면 되니, 총 7개의 열만 가져와 작업을 했다. ReadExcel 메서드: @Override public void excelReader(String uri) { File file = new File(uri); Workbook wb = null; ArrayList tempArray = new ArrayList(); try { wb = Workbook.getWorkbook(file); Sheet sheet = wb.getSheet(0); Cell cell = null; int n = 4; while (true) { try { for (i..

[JAVA]/JExcel 2021. 3. 26. 16:24
"웹 개발자 양성과정" 03.25 문제 풀이 <엑셀에 있는 데이터 다루기>

즉, 검색 콘솔 창에서 검색 조건과 내용을 입력하면 제시한 조건에 해당하는 데이터를 추출하여, excel파일과 HTML 파일로 저장하라는 문제다. 첫 구현은 1. 데이터를 한글로 변환 2. 조건이 2개 이상일 때 두 조건의 and연산 을 제외하고 잘 구현을 시켰으나, 이 두가지가 정말 시간이 많이 들어가는 작업이었다. 알고 있는 검색 알고리즘을 어떻게 해야 효율적으로 사용할 수 있을 지 잘 생각이 안나서, 그냥 죄다 일일이 비교하여 검색을 진행하였다. 우선, 1. 데이터를 한글로 변환 이 작업은 무한 else if문을 사용하여 구현하려고 했으나 강사님이 정말 효율적인 방법을 제시해주어 그걸 사용하였다. Code: package com.choonham.util; public class EnglishToHa..

[JAVA]/JExcel 2021. 3. 25. 17:10
"웹 개발자 양성과정" 03.24 <jExcel Api>

API를 사용하기 위해 필요한 사전 지식 엑셀 파일 쓰기 파일 경로 지정 : File fname=new File("data.xls");​​ 사용할 엑셀 파일 생성 : WritableWorkbook wb=Workbook.createWorkbook(File 객체); 엑셀 파일내에 시트 생성 : WritableSheet s1=WritableWorkbook.createSheet("이름", index); 라벨 생성 : Label label=new Label(열번호, 행번호, "내용"); 시트에 라벨 적용 : WritableSheet.addCell(Label 객체); 엑셀 파일 읽기 파일 경로 지정 : File fname=new File("data.xls"); 엑셀 파일 객체 얻기 : Workbook wb=Work..

[JAVA]/JExcel 2021. 3. 25. 17:08
이전 1 다음
이전 다음
최근에 올라온 글
최근에 달린 댓글
TAG
  • 인천 구월동 맛집
  • javascript
  • 정보보안기사 #실기 #정리
  • 인천 구월동 이탈리안 맛집
  • 이탈리안 레스토랑
  • await
  • redux-thunk
  • 파니노구스토
  • react-native
  • react
  • Async
  • 맛집
  • AsyncStorage
  • redux
  • Promise
more
Total
Today
Yesterday

Powered by Tistory / Designed by INJE

티스토리툴바